Test lib refactor#5
Merged
Merged
Conversation
…formance monitoring
- Optimize PowerShell commit message formatting - Add error handling for commit operations - Improve documentation for multi-line commits - Update examples with PowerShell best practices BREAKING CHANGE: Requires PowerShell 5.1+
- Fix Prisma mock expectations by removing lastActiveUrl from select clause - Update date handling to use ISO strings consistently - Verify and maintain proper error handling and debugging - Confirm performance monitoring with THRESHOLDS - Update test plan with completed status
- Replace custom timer with measureTestTime helper - Add proper performance monitoring with THRESHOLDS - Add proper type assertions for response data - Add afterEach and afterAll hooks for cleanup - Add proper mock state debugging - Standardize error handling patterns - Fix mock user setup for DELETE tests - Update test plan with progress
- Add proper error handling and debugging - Implement performance monitoring - Fix file mock implementations - Update test data management - Update plan with progress
- Mark icons API test as complete - Update progress to 90% - Update remaining tasks count - Add detailed progress history entry
- Fix factory function imports (createTestUrl, createTestUrlGroup) - Update Request to NextRequest with proper imports - Fix RouteContext type to use Promise for params - Update mock implementations for better type safety - Fix test data structure to match route expectations - Add proper error handling and debugging - Maintain performance monitoring All tests passing with proper type safety
- Move API test review task to completed tasks\n- Update plan.md with completion details\n- Update testing framework documentation with best practices\n- Apply consistent error handling and performance monitoring patterns
…iew work - Mark completed items from API test review\n- Add progress history entry for API test review integration\n- Update implementation priorities\n- Reorganize next steps
- Update progress percentage to 85%\n- Add completed milestones\n- Update description and target date\n- Add last update entry with API test review integration
🔍 Lint Results |
🧪 Test Results |
🏗️ Build Results |
🔍 Lint Results |
🧪 Test Results\n✅ Tests completed successfully in 43s.\n Passed: 0 |
🏗️ Build Results |
🔍 Lint Results |
🧪 Test Results\n❌ Tests failed or did not report results correctly in s.\n\n Please check the test logs for more details. |
🏗️ Build Results |
🔍 Lint Results |
🧪 Test Results\n❌ Tests failed or did not report results correctly in s.\n\n Please check the test logs for more details. |
🏗️ Build Results |
- Move task from active to completed - Update directory path reference - Add key achievements - Update last modified timestamp
🔍 Lint Results |
🧪 Test Results\n❌ Tests failed or did not report results correctly in s.\n\n Please check the test logs for more details. |
🏗️ Build Results |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
No description provided.